Frequently Asked Questions about Cleveland
How much are Studio apartments in Cleveland?
There are currently 641 Studio Apartments in Cleveland with rent ranges from $600 to $2,425 with an average price of $1,263.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cleveland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cleveland ranges from $419 to $6,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,580.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cleveland c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cleveland range from $685 to $6,750.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,767.
How expensive are Cleveland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 561 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cleveland on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$554 to $10,968 - averaging $1,916 for the location.
